首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

NUXT SSR安装挂钩

NUXT SSR(Server-Side Rendering)是NUXT.js框架中的一种渲染模式,它允许在服务器端生成完整的HTML页面,并将其发送给客户端。这种渲染模式的安装和挂钩可以通过以下步骤完成:

  1. 安装NUXT.js:首先,你需要在你的开发环境中安装NUXT.js。你可以通过以下命令使用npm进行安装:
代码语言:txt
复制
npm install nuxt
  1. 创建NUXT.js项目:在安装NUXT.js之后,你可以使用NUXT.js提供的命令行工具创建一个新的NUXT.js项目。运行以下命令:
代码语言:txt
复制
npx create-nuxt-app <project-name>

其中,<project-name>是你想要给项目起的名称。

  1. 配置NUXT SSR:在NUXT.js项目中,你可以通过编辑nuxt.config.js文件来配置NUXT SSR。在该文件中,你可以设置各种选项,如路由、插件、构建配置等。你可以根据自己的需求进行配置。
  2. 使用NUXT挂钩:NUXT.js提供了一些生命周期钩子函数,你可以在这些钩子函数中执行特定的操作。在NUXT SSR中,你可以使用以下钩子函数来安装和挂钩NUXT SSR:
  • beforeCreate:在组件实例创建之前调用,可以在这里进行一些初始化操作。
  • created:在组件实例创建之后调用,可以在这里进行一些异步数据的获取。
  • beforeMount:在组件挂载之前调用,可以在这里进行一些准备工作。
  • mounted:在组件挂载之后调用,可以在这里进行一些DOM操作。
  1. 示例代码:
代码语言:txt
复制
export default {
  beforeCreate() {
    // 在组件实例创建之前调用
    // 进行一些初始化操作
  },
  created() {
    // 在组件实例创建之后调用
    // 进行一些异步数据的获取
  },
  beforeMount() {
    // 在组件挂载之前调用
    // 进行一些准备工作
  },
  mounted() {
    // 在组件挂载之后调用
    // 进行一些DOM操作
  }
}

NUXT SSR的优势在于可以提供更好的SEO(搜索引擎优化)和更快的首次加载速度,因为页面的HTML内容是在服务器端生成的。它适用于需要更好的搜索引擎可索引性和更好的用户体验的应用场景。

腾讯云相关产品中,推荐使用云服务器(CVM)来部署NUXT SSR应用。你可以通过以下链接了解腾讯云云服务器的详细信息:腾讯云云服务器

请注意,以上答案仅供参考,具体的安装和挂钩步骤可能因NUXT.js版本的不同而有所差异。建议在实际开发中参考NUXT.js官方文档和相关资源进行操作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券